Dog ownership comes with plenty of joy and at least one chore nobody brags about. Joe Longo sits down with Angela Martini of Martini Pet Services to talk about the surprisingly smart, highly practical world of residential pet waste removal and why a professional pooper scooper service can be a game-changer for busy households. If you’ve ever looked at your yard after a long week or faced the spring snowmelt mess and thought, “There has to be a better way,” this conversation is for you. 

Angela shares how she got into the scoop-and-poop business while looking for a path to self-employment and how that decision turned into a decade-long local service. We get into the details that matter: one-time cleanups, weekly visits (the most popular option), every-other-week scheduling, and monthly service, plus how “reset” cleanups help customers reclaim their yards when the seasons change. Along the way, Angela tackles the biggest misconception head-on: hiring someone to clean up dog poop is not about laziness, it’s about time, workload, and making your home easier to enjoy. 

We also talk small business marketing and customer growth, including why Facebook is her strongest channel, how referrals keep the business moving, and how Martini Pet Services keeps the brand fun with holiday dress-up and little client surprises. You’ll come away with a clear picture of how a niche local business creates real value, builds trust, and stays memorable in the community.

So we have different options. We actually have options for pretty much anybody, except for if you walk your dog, well, we're not gonna follow you, but um we do one-time cleanups um weekly, which is our most popular. We do every other week, once a month, all different options. Um, some yards uh people have more dogs or smaller yards, they get more frequency. And some people need a reset. So we come out like after spring. We just got done with our mad rush of after the snow melts cleanups. So that's a good time for us.

Yeah. Wow. It's it's it's so interesting. And this is a great question to ask. What are some of the misconceptions about your industry?

SPEAKER_02

The biggest one that we hear all the time, well, maybe not as much anymore, but we used to hear is that anybody who hires somebody to clean up their dog poop is lazy and they shouldn't own a dog, which is totally false. The majority of our clients are extremely busy, other business owners, um, people who have two jobs, or they're running the kids all over the place. So they just don't for it.
